VIDEO: Dragons are tamed as Blue & Gold end 2026 NXT Gen League home campaign on a winning high

Team Bath Netball finished their 2026 NXT Gen League home campaign in fine style as they beat LexisNexis Dragons 58-52 in front of a big and appreciative crowd.

On an afternoon when netball across the South West of England was celebrated through the on-court presentation of end-of-season awards, the Blue & Gold’s senior team lived up to the occasion by producing one of their best performances of the year.

An entertaining first half ended with Team Bath leading their Cardiff-based opponents 28-24 and they went on to make a decisive break during an excellent third quarter, stretching their advantage to 48-38.

Dragons edged the final quarter 14-10 but Team Bath, inspired by a Most Valuable Player performance from Lottie Robinson, were full value for their third home victory of the season in a match sponsored by Bechtle.

The Blue & Gold will conclude their 2026 campaign with two visits to the East Midlands, where they will face second-placed Loughborough Lightning on Saturday 23rd May (2.30pm) and Nottingham Forest on Sunday 31st May (3pm).

Match stats

Team Bath Netball starting combination: GK Daisy Harrison, GD Lottie Robinson, WD Poppy Tydeman, C Becca Hinkins, WA Lowri Windsor, GA Daisy Collett, GS Lucy Herdman. Impact players: Sydney Sawyers, Ellie Ervine, Ellen Morgan, Saskia Lea, Katherine Mansfield.

LexisNexis Dragons starting combination: GK Caris Morgan, GD Ellie Blackwell, WD Thea Rhodes, C Georgia Hellerman, WA Celyn Emanuel, GA Charlotte Steer, GS Nansi Kuti. Impact players: Zoe Matthewman, Liv Selby, Effie Robinson, Fearne Maine, Alice Clark.

Quarter scores (Team Bath first): Q1 17-13; Q2 28-24 (11-11); Q3 48-38 (20-14); Q4 58-52 (10-14).

Most Valuable Player: Lottie Robinson.
